    What Do Skull Drawings Symbolize in Art?

    Skulls can have different meanings to many different people. It has been used to symbolize the remembrance of our human mortality and that our time here on this earth is not permanent. It has also been used to represent transformation and the transition between life and death, or into the next “realm”.
